Five teachers or staff members at Headlands High have been charged in less than three years. Here's a breakdown of how the endless scandals have all played out:
Three years ago, an art instructor by the name of Ian Blott (man, these stories can't be real, can they?) received a blot on his record and four years in prison for forcing himself on a teenage girl. The girl claimed that she was traumatized from the encounter and left with bulimia and other medical problems.
In 2007, Steven Edwards, until then a science teacher, was convicted of having sex with three students (their genders not identified here) and is now serving a five-year sentence. The abuse/relationships occurred over the course of four years, but only came to light after Blott's trial.
Even after two such cases in as many years, school officials did nothing to or were unable to stop the tidal wave: two more teachers were arrested last year. Terry Mann, a teacher, had sex with a student from another school and somehow managed to escape with a suspended sentence, possibly because he plead guilty and admitted everything immediately. One of his colleagues, a teacher's assistant, also received a slap on the wrist for carrying on a long-term relationship with a boy at school.
Again, the school did nothing to successfully control its staff.
The fifth case came to light last week, when Chris Reen, who works as a substitute or fill-in at the school (what, the janitors are getting in on this, too?), was arrested for seven sexual encounters with a girl throughout the end of 2008.
